How much does hamster adoption cost?

Hamster adoption costs:

  • Adoption Fee: Usually free
  • Cage and Supplies: $50-200
  • Food and Toys: $20-50
  • Veterinary Expenses: $30-80
  • Initial Supplies: $40-100
  • Monthly Care: $15-40

What should I consider before adopting a hamster?

Things to consider before adopting a hamster:

  1. Lifestyle: Does it suit the hamster's needs?
  2. Home Conditions: Is there enough space and security?
  3. Time Commitment: Do you have time for daily care?
  4. Financial Situation: Can you afford care costs?
  5. Family Members: Is everyone ready?
  6. Future Plans: Do you have long-term commitment?
